Our funeral home in Perth is located at 15 Gore Street West. We are proud to be an independent family funeral home, in our fourth generation of family service. We serve the communities of Perth, Smiths Falls, Lanark and surrounding communities. Our funeral home in Perth is the third oldest continually operated facility in Ontario, founded in 1836. The Blair family involvement began in the early 1900’s when Alex Blair purchased a share from David Hogg and went into partnership with the Thompson family. Shortly thereafter, he purchased the remaining portion of the business. The funeral home has evolved many times over the years beginning as a part of the furniture store. In 1939 the current chapel was constructed with additions coming in the 70’s and 80’s. In 2002 a milestone occurred with the construction of a new home furnishings facility on Highway 7 at the eastern end of Perth.
